I've said this before about Walker but he is like a world class corner back in American Football, where they start to have quiet games because the opposition team doesn't even bother trying to target the wide receiver on their side.

There's just no point. Chelsea tried it with Werner a couple of times, PSG with Mbappe, but after 20 minutes they just realise it's completely futile trying to attack down that side of the pitch.

I don't think it's been appreciated how much he's improved in attack. Not typical fullback overlapping + crossing stuff, but his forward passing has improved so much, he now regularly plays really dangerous through balls into KDB and the false 9 from his right back position.
